A dominant performance by the Indian U20 men’s team led to a 3-0 victory over Pakistan in the SAFF U20 Championship 2026. Omang Dodum’s two goals in the second half, along with an early strike by Vishal Yadav, secured the win for the Blue Colts. This victory ensured India’s place in the semifinals and eliminated Pakistan from the tournament.
India started strong with Yadav’s early goal and continued to press forward. Despite Pakistan’s attempts to equalize, goalkeeper Suraj Singh Aheibam’s crucial saves maintained India’s clean sheet. Dodum’s brace in the second half sealed the comprehensive win for the Indian team.
The match saw India’s defense standing tall against Pakistan’s attacking efforts. With a two-goal lead, India controlled the game’s tempo while Pakistan struggled to break through. Dodum’s clinical finish from a penalty kick in the 88th minute sealed the victory for India.
India’s victory sets them up well for the tournament, with a top spot in Group B within reach. The Blue Colts will now face Bangladesh in their final group-stage match, aiming to secure their place at the top of the group and advance to the semifinals.
